Chula Vista: A Budget-Friendly Adventure!

Experience the beauty of Chula Vista without breaking the bank.

21 June 2023

Chula Vista, United States is a perfect destination for budget travelers with its affordable accommodation options and a plethora of free outdoor activities, including hiking, cycling, and beachcombing. Visitors can explore the city's rich cultural heritage by visiting the historic downtown area and attending local events and festivals. Chula Vista also offers budget-friendly dining options, featuring delicious Mexican cuisine and international fusion food.

How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Chula Vista by plane is to fly into San Diego International Airport and then take a taxi or drive about 15 miles south on I-5 to reach Chula Vista.

Car

Driving to Chula Vista is a convenient option, as it is located near two major highways: I-5 and I-805. From north of Chula Vista, take I-5 south until you reach the desired exit. From the east, take I-8 west to I-5 south. From the south, take I-5 north to the desired exit.

Train

Unfortunately, there is no train station in Chula Vista. The closest Amtrak station is in San Diego, about 15 miles north, and from there you would need to take a taxi or drive to Chula Vista.

Boat

Unfortunately, there are no boat options to get to Chula Vista. The closest marina is in San Diego, about 15 miles north of Chula Vista. You would need to arrange for ground transportation to reach Chula Vista from there.

Bus

Taking a Greyhound bus is a budget-friendly way to get to Chula Vista. The closest bus station is in downtown San Diego, about 15 miles north of Chula Vista. From there you would need to take a taxi or bus to reach Chula Vista.
